One of the most intimidating moments a marketer can experience is starting from “zero.” The idea of launching a new program—particularly an initiative as intense as a blog—can feel daunting, exciting, and stressful all at once.

Anytime marketers launch a new program, they’re under tremendous scrutiny and pressure. Even though something like a blog takes months to take off, executives will often ask for status updates and “results” right away.

What you need are resources that help you bypass the exploratory phase by helping you learn from the experiences of others. Here are some favorites to get you started:
